Future-proofing the public library
Authors:Maria Lorena Lehman
Institution:1. Sensing Architecture ? Academy | MLL Design Lab, LLC, Massachusetts, USAmll@mlldesignlab.com
Abstract:To help guide the public library into the future, architectural design stands as a linchpin that bridges between vast amounts of proliferating information, the librarians who make sense of that information, and the library goers who engage and activate with that information. Future-proofing the public library calls for its evolution, where library buildings grow into new roles that serve as sensorial “idea gardens,” where the presence of virtual and augmented mediums complement the physical book, instead of displacing or replacing its many benefits. To create this type of bridge, it is the architectural design of the public library that can lead the way.
